Q:
What is the best way to use the ADAT bridge with a USD and BRC?
A:
We have seen the best results by plugging the ADAT bridge word out to BRC 48k in (and make sure to set the BRC to external sync and choose 48k in as the sync source). Put Pro Tools in internal sync (not optical). This setup works for either transferring or recording to an adat. Also, this setup allows for your 888/24, 888 or 882 to be the main interface with the ADAT bridge slaved to it.
